The Samsung Galaxy S25 5G is the latest flagship from the South Korean tech giant that promises to disrupt the smartphone market with its cutting-edge technology, sleek design, and innovative features. Released in early 2025, this new addition showcases Samsung's prowess in melding sophistication with functionality, tailor-made for tech enthusiasts and everyday users alike.
One of the most striking aspects of the Samsung Galaxy S25 5G is its premium design. Measuring a comfortable 146.9 mm in height, 70.5 mm in width, and a mere 7.2 mm in thickness, the device is a marvel of compact engineering. Despite its robust 4000 mAh battery, it weighs just 162 grams, offering a lightweight feel without compromising on power.
The 6.16-inch display is surrounded by an ultra-thin bezel, maximizing screen real estate while providing an immersive viewing experience. The phone utilizes self-illuminating display technology with a resolution of 1080x2340 pixels and an impressive pixel density of 419 PPI. This ensures vibrant colors and crisp visuals, making it a delight for media consumption and gaming.
Under the hood, the Samsung Galaxy S25 5G is powered by the advanced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Elite for Galaxy SM8750-AC processor, coupled with the Qualcomm Adreno 830 GPU. This combination ensures that the device not only handles everyday tasks with ease but also excels in running demanding applications and games, thanks to its 12 GB RAM.
Users have various storage options to suit their needs, ranging from 128 GB to 512 GB, providing ample space for apps, photos, and all those ultra-high-definition videos you will be capturing.
The Samsung Galaxy S25 5G sets a new benchmark in smartphone photography with its 50.1 MP main camera. Boasting features like Electronic Image Stabilization (EIS), Optical Image Stabilization (OIS), and a variety of HDR options, it allows photographers of all levels to produce stunning images and videos. The camera supports video recording at an astonishing 7680x4320 pixels at 30 fps, perfect for those who want to capture cinema-quality videos.
The front camera is no slouch either, with 12 MP resolution and capabilities like HDR photo and video, slow-motion, and a range of intelligent scene detection features for stellar selfies and video calls.
The Samsung Galaxy S25 5G lives up to its name with its robust connectivity features. Supporting both 5G UW and 5G networks, the device ensures ultra-fast internet speeds and seamless connectivity in a future-ready network landscape. Moreover, the integration of the latest Wi-Fi 7 technology offers smoother and faster wireless performance than ever before, bolstered by Bluetooth 5.4 for top-notch peripheral connectivity.
This smartphone isn't just about raw power and high-end specs; it's about providing a holistic technological experience. The Galaxy S25 5G is equipped with a range of sensors including an in-screen fingerprint sensor, accelerometer, gyroscope, barometer, and more, all contributing to a smart and seamless user experience.
Moreover, features such as aug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) support, voice command capabilities, and intelligent personal assistant functionalities make this device not just a phone, but a digital companion that evolves with you.
With options for PMA and Qi wireless charging and a robust 1-cell lithium-ion battery, the Galaxy S25 5G ensures longevity and convenience, making it a worthy upgrade for anyone looking to embrace the future of mobile technology.

The smartphone landscape in 2024 is as competitive as ever, and Motorola has made a bold move with its release of the Moto G53s 5G. Designed by Lenovo, this new iteration builds on the brand’s legacy of delivering performance and style without the premium price tag. Available in versions with 4 GB and 8 GB of RAM, the Moto G53s 5G packs an array of features and innovations that make it a standout option for smartphone users globally.
At the heart of the Motorola Moto G53s 5G is the Qualcomm Snapdragon 480+ 5G SM4350-AC (Holi) processor, complemented by the Qualcomm Adreno 619 GPU. These components ensure smooth performance, whether for everyday tasks or more demanding applications. The device runs on Android OS, offering a seamless and intuitive user experience. It comes in two RAM options, 4 GB and 8 GB, ensuring flexibility for different user needs and handling multitasking with ease.
The phone offers 128 GB of storage, providing ample space for apps, photos, and videos. Powering the device is a robust 5000 mAh lithium-ion polymer battery, offering long-lasting usage with the convenience of 30W fast charging.
The Motorola Moto G53s 5G features a 6.5-inch LED display, with a resolution of 720x1600 pixels and a pixel density of 270 PPI. This ensures vibrant colors and sharp visuals, ideal for media consumption and gaming. The display supports a refresh rate of 120 Hz, enhancing the fluidity of interactions, while a peak touch sampling rate of 240 Hz ensures responsiveness to user inputs.
Weighing just 183 grams and measuring 8.19 mm in thickness, the device is designed to be both lightweight and comfortable to hold. The dimensions of 162.7 mm in height and 74.66 mm in width give it an ergonomic feel, making it easy to use with one hand.
Photography enthusiasts will appreciate the main camera's 50.1 MP resolution, complete with features like an optical zoom of 1.0x and digital zoom up to 8.0x. Video capabilities include capturing moments in [1920x1080 pixels] at 60 frames per second. The front camera doesn't disappoint either, with 8 MP resolution and packed with features like HDR photo, panorama, face detection, and retouching capabilities.
Main camera features also include video stabilizer (EIS), Pixel unification, HDR photo, and much more. This suite of tools empowers users to explore their creative sides thoroughly.
When it comes to special features, the Moto G53s 5G is not lacking. It comes equipped with voice commands, navigation software, an intelligent personal assistant, and even face recognition for added security. These features, combined with a fingerprint sensor and the array of connectivity options (including Bluetooth 5.1 and various WiFi standards), ensure the device is ready to handle any task.
Sensors such as the light intensity sensor, proximity sensor, accelerometer, compass, and gyroscope further enhance the device's functionality, creating a more interactive and responsive experience.
